Experienced Shoppers Are Styling Cowboy Boots With This Specific Denim Trend to Make Them Look Less Costume-y
Just because it’s not Halloween or festival season doesn’t mean fashion people have stopped wearing cowboy boots. It’s quite the opposite. Every day this summer, someone new is stepping out in a pair, and most of the time, they’re styling them with flowy maxi dresses to look polished. However, Kendall Jenner just made a case for styling cowboy boots with something other than a breezy dress—another way that doesn’t look costume-y, and the secret to her look was frayed-hem denim Bermuda shorts.
Yesterday, Jenner posted several photos on Instagram from a recent trip. In one image, Jenner was standing in a grassy field, wearing a baseball cap, a striped button-down shirt, a tank top, low-rise denim Bermuda shorts with frayed hems, and distressed cowboy boots that reached mid-calf.
What makes frayed-hem denim Bermuda shorts and cowboy boots a perfect pairing is their contrast. The jean shorts offer an effortless vibe with their relaxed, baggy fit and lived-in look from the raw hem. Meanwhile, the leather cowboy boots bring a more structured, refined feel that balances the casualness of the denim nicely.
